EDH apologizes
The Directorate General of Electricity of Haiti (EDH) apologizes to its customers for the reduction in the power supply time during the past 2 weeks. This is due to a scarcity of fuel at the Carrefour and Varreux power stations.

André Michel rejects the Core Group position
"The position of the Core Group is chimerical https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-32381-haiti-flash-the-core-group-is-getting-impatient-and-pushing-for-the-elections.html . We cannot talk about elections in a country controlled by armed groups that operate with impunity. Only a responsible political transition will put the country back on democratic tracks," André Michel, leader of the radical opposition of the so-called" democratic and popular movement".

The disconnected foreign exchange market...
"What is happening on the foreign exchange market has very little connection to the fundamentals of the economy. Three entities manipulate the market and engage in speculation. Two of the three are illegal, they are the formal banking sector and the informal sector. The other legal, legitimate : the BRH" declared the economist Dr Eddy N. Labossière.

Arrival of 274,000 barrels of fuel
"A shipment of 137,000 barrels of Petroleum Products arrived in Port-au-Prince this week aboard the MT KLARA Ship carrying 120,000 barrels of Gasoline and 17,000 barrels of Jet. The unloading is currently underway at the Varreux Terminal," informed the Office for the Monetization of Development Assistance Programs (BMPAD).

Maarten Boute appointed Economic Advisor for Belgium
This week the Belgian Embassy in Haiti appointed Maarten Boute (of Belgian origin) President and CEO of Digicel, as Economic Diplomatic Advisor for Belgium in Haiti.

The French Embassy welcomes Jean Bart's dismissal appeal
The French Embassy welcomes the decision of the Haitian judicial authorities to appeal the decision of dismissal https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-32388-haiti-news-zapping.html rendered in favor of Yves Jean -Bart https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-32332-haiti-flash-dismissal-order-for-yves-jean-bart-president-of-the-fhf-in-the-case-of-sexual-abuse.html the former President of the Haitian Football Federation (FHF) in the case of allegations of sexual assault on female players, a decision that paves the way for an impartial and independent appeal trial. In this perspective, it is necessary to ensure the safety of witnesses and alleged victims and to protect them from any threat or attempted intimidation.
